Tenders invited for "Road Improvement Works in West Kowloon Reclamation Development"
************************************************************

     The Highways Department today (January 24) invited tenders for "Road Improvement Works in West Kowloon Reclamation Development" (Contract No. HY/2013/17).

     The works are expected to commence in July this year and will take about 32 months to complete. The works will mainly comprise:

- construction of an elevated single lane carriageway connecting Hoi Po Road to the West Kowloon Highway northbound;

- construction of an elevated single lane carriageway connecting the elevated Nga Cheung Road to the Western Harbour Crossing toll plaza;

- construction of an at-grade single lane carriageway connecting the West Kowloon Highway southbound to Nga Cheung Road;

- improvement works at Canton Road, including the three junctions with Austin Road/Austin Road West, Wui Cheung Road, and Jordan Road/Ferry Street; and

- civil and road works, geotechnical works, electrical and mechanical works, ground investigation works, modification works for existing structures, drainage and utility works, and landscaping works associated with the above works.
